When does a flooring need a permit in City of Tacoma?

2021 IRC R105.2(1)(j) exempts floor finishes (carpet, vinyl, hardwood, tile). Permit required if subfloor structure is modified, joists altered, or radiant heat installed.

Notes & caveats

Per TMC 2.02.540 amendment to IRC R105.2: "Painting, papering, tiling, carpeting, cabinets, counter tops and similar finish work" are exempt from permit requirements. Floor finish work alone does not require a permit.
